Ram Navami – 17 April 2024
Rama Navami, observed on the ninth day of Shukla Paksha of the Hindu month of Chaitra, is celebrated by people across the nation commemorating the birth of Lord Ram, the seventh Avatar of Lord Vishnu. In 2024, the Rama Navami is on the 17th of April.
On April 17, the sun rises at 06:08 AM and sets at 06:44 PM. The Navami Tithi commences at 01:24 PM on April 16th and ends at 03:14 PM the following day. The Puja Muhurat is from 11:10 AM to 01:42 PM, and the Rama Navami Madhyahna Moment is at 12:26 PM.
Lord Rama was born to bring peace and prosperity, to save people from evil, and to end the riotous reign of the demon king Ravana. Devotees observe fasting, recite the Holy Ramayan, enchant hymns and mantras, and many other special rituals and functions are organized, marking the birth of Lord Ram.
In many parts of the country, the day is also observed as the marriage anniversary of Lord Ram and Sita. In South India, Kalyanotsavam, a ceremonial wedding, is arranged to mark the marriage of Rama and Sita.
